Transaction 6d48bb25b7036ff23416459b33788670fceb4bb93fed8a9a3b39d4b7de17e29f
2 Input
2 Outputs
- 6d48bb25b7036ff23416459b33788670fceb4bb93fed8a9a3b39d4b7de17e29f:0
- 6d48bb25b7036ff23416459b33788670fceb4bb93fed8a9a3b39d4b7de17e29f:1
value 90537350
address 34WBAK5hAGnRrsyH4YSwq5rJY66moHx18x
value 561589480
address 336Ka4riKSN4ZaNGNW7hBZ6Cu2NHxUEKoj